I'm saying that everything humans do is necessarily derivative. Originality is not about new ideas, it is about combining old ideas into new combinations. And this painting does just that. The artist is probably trying to communicate a ship of Theseus of sorts, hence the name of the painting. What makes a Picasso painting a Picasso painting? That's what this is about.
